Ticket: Staging env misconfigured for Siftgate bloom filter

The bloom layer in front of the Pellet KV store is rejecting all lookups in staging because the env file was copied from the dev template without credentials. False-positive tuning values are fine; only the auth line is missing. To unblock the weekly demo, the Pellet admission secret must be set on the following line.

env line for yaguf-fajop: LEDGER_TOKEN13=fb08984397349

## Clock skew limits on build agents

Pennywhistle CI signs artifacts with timestamps, so agents must stay within a bounded skew of the coordinator. Agents exceeding the limit are drained automatically and rejoin after NTP resync. Support can point customers complaining about "stale signature" errors to this page. The enforced thresholds are the following.

constants for bagaf-hadup:
QUOTAS = {
    "quenael": 1,
    "ralwyn": 1,
    "oliath": 2,
    "ulaael": 2,
}

Minutes — Management Meeting, Keldworth office. Attendees: T. Brannock, S. Ilvesdóttir, R. Quayne. Agenda item: currency hedging for the Ostrevan contract. After reviewing exposure scenarios, management approved forward contracts covering 70% of projected receivables for twelve months, with quarterly review. Treasury to document counterparty limits and report monthly. Quayne noted audit implications; these will be minuted separately. The commercially sensitive rationale is recorded below.

confidential, kagup-bafog: Fraaxax Group is in early talks to buy Soroxox Group for about $343.8 million. The Olidor launch date is June 14, and nothing goes to the press before then. Legal wants the Aldmirek Logistics term sheet signed before July 23.